Adivasi session begins in Kokrajhar
Over 1000 delegates from various district of Assam thronged Kokrajhar to attend the 12th Adivasi Mahasabha which got underway on Friday. Organised by the All Adivasi Students Association of Assam, the event got off to a colourful start at Magurmari High School ground in Kokrajhar.
Former minister Pramila Rani Brahma attended the first session and welcomed the delegates. AASAA vice president Stephen Lakra told reporters that more than 1000 delegates reached the venue. He said that the session will discuss culture, language and development spirits of the Adivasi community in the state. Dr Rameswar Oraon, chairman of national commission for Scheduled Tribes would attend as chief guest on October 4.
